Highlands At Westridge is a master-planned neighborhood located in the northwestern section of McKinney, Texas. It’s known for its organized layout, newer construction, and a strong sense of community among residents. This area stands out in McKinney for its cohesive development and proximity to several of the city’s main commuter routes.
Compared to older McKinney neighborhoods closer to downtown, Highlands At Westridge offers a more modern suburban feel. The neighborhood is popular with buyers seeking relatively recent construction, easy access to shopping and schools, and a variety of recreational amenities built into the community design. Sellers here often highlight the neighborhood’s well-maintained common areas and the convenience of its location within the Dallas metroplex.
Location and Surroundings
Highlands At Westridge sits in the northwestern corner of McKinney, just east of Custer Road and north of Eldorado Parkway. The neighborhood is situated near the border with Frisco and Prosper, which gives residents quick access to shopping, dining, and entertainment options in multiple cities. Major roads like FM 2478 (Custer Road) and Highway 380 are both within a short drive, making it straightforward for residents to commute toward Plano, Frisco, or central McKinney.
Getting around the area is convenient thanks to the grid of wide, well-maintained streets within the neighborhood itself. Most errands can be accomplished within a short drive, with grocery stores, coffee shops, and services located just outside the main entrances. The neighborhood’s location on the far west side of McKinney also means less through-traffic, which many residents appreciate.
Homes in Highlands At Westridge
Homes in Highlands At Westridge are primarily single-family residences built between the mid-2000s and the late 2010s. The neighborhood features a mix of one- and two-story houses, with brick and stone exteriors being the most common architectural styles. Open floor plans, attached garages, and energy-efficient features are typical, reflecting the era of construction and the preferences of modern buyers.
Lots in this neighborhood are generally moderate in size, providing enough outdoor space for gardening or entertaining without the upkeep of larger, older properties in other parts of McKinney. Many homes back up to greenbelts or walking trails, and some sections of the neighborhood offer cul-de-sac living for those seeking additional privacy. The HOA maintains common areas and enforces architectural guidelines, which helps keep the neighborhood’s appearance consistent and appealing.
Over the years, Highlands At Westridge has seen steady growth as new phases have been added. This has brought a wider range of floor plans and builders, but the neighborhood maintains a cohesive look thanks to consistent landscaping and community standards.
Daily Life in Highlands At Westridge
Residents of Highlands At Westridge often take advantage of the neighborhood’s amenities, which include a community pool, playgrounds, and walking trails. These features encourage outdoor activity and make it easy to connect with neighbors. The area is also served by several parks nearby, and the Westridge Golf Course is just down the road for those interested in golf or scenic walks.
Daily routines often revolve around quick trips to nearby shopping centers along Custer Road and Eldorado Parkway, where you’ll find grocery stores, pharmacies, and dining options. The neighborhood is served by the Frisco and Prosper Independent School Districts, depending on the section, which is a frequent topic of discussion for buyers considering the area.
Weekend activities might include a visit to nearby Stonebridge Ranch shopping or heading to downtown McKinney for local events. The neighborhood’s design encourages a relaxed pace, with plenty of sidewalks and green spaces for morning jogs or evening strolls.
